Output 31a1aa3f60a8b2ed65beede2c0a344f8d47807a0656272911b7337e7435b3721:2

value
28941075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a308b7389e50d5a7d4e0787c690b8526c7b86d7 OP_EQUAL
address
3HCtx6sSVTLNZKSwE5fH7Cy4HPWjxy9VMP
transaction
31a1aa3f60a8b2ed65beede2c0a344f8d47807a0656272911b7337e7435b3721
spent
true